Florida Woman Kills Stalker

HEATHROW, Fla. (AP) -- A greenskeeper who stalked a woman for months was shot and killed by the woman after he entered her home with a handgun and rope.

Donald Cook had repeatedly called Elizabeth MaGruder, spying on her with binoculars and skulking behind bushes as she golfed.

On Monday, he entered her home in an upscale gated community. Cook pulled a .25-caliber handgun from his waist and aimed it at Mrs. MaGruder's husband.

Mrs. MaGruder, 50, ran to a linen closet and got a gun. When Cook burst through the door, she fired her .38-caliber revolver once at close range and hit him in the chest, authorities said.

Cook fired back five times, hitting Mrs. MaGruder in the abdomen and wrist.

Mrs. MaGruder was listed in stable condition Tuesday.

Seminole County Sheriff Don Eslinger said Tuesday that Mrs. MaGruder acted in self-defense and would not be charged.

Cook, 50, had been fired six months ago from Heathrow Country Club after Mrs. MaGruder complained about his constant phone calls. Mrs. MaGruder had hired Cook to work on her yard last year, but she stopped using him when she became uncomfortable with his attention, Eslinger said.
